While turning left with a green circular traffic light at a controlled intersection, our client, a motorcyclist, was t-boned by another motorcyclist traveling straight in the opposite direction. Our client had a passenger on his motorcycle. Both drivers and the passenger were seriously injured. Only our client had automobile insurance, which included uninsured/underinsured motorist (UM/UIM) coverage. Our client's insurer, State Farm, initially denied our client's claim for Uninsured Motorist benefits claiming our client was 100% at fault. We retained an accident reconstruction expert to show that the other motorcyclist was speeding at nearly double the speed limit as he traveled uphill towards the crest of the hill where the intersection was located creating a visual obstruction for our client. With the accident reconstruction report and formal opinions obtained from our client's medical providers, vocational expert and functional capacity expert, we successfully convinced State Farm to enter into a seven-figure settlement .

Total Settlement: $1,000,000

A young girl was bitten by a pit bull. While playing in her grandmother's front yard, the child saw a man walking a dog towards her. She walked toward the man and his dog, stopped, and asked to pet the dog. The man told her that it was okay, but to be careful. As the child reached to pet the dog, the dog lunged and bit her on her cheek. Law enforcement was notified and responded to the scene. Animal control investigated the incident and, initially, issued a Dangerous Dog Declaration to the dog owner. However, for unexplained reasons, Animal Control changed its determination and ruled that the young child provoked the dog.

The bite caused a two-inch laceration on the child's cheek. She underwent medical care, including plastic surgery treatments, totaling approximately $18,000. Despite Animal Control's ridiculous determination, we successfully recovered the dog owner's $300,000 homeowners insurance policy with Allstate Insurance.

Total Settlement: $300,000 Policy Limits

Our client was stopped for a red light when she was hit from behind. The rearend car accident was caught on dash cam which demonstrated a low speed collision with minimal property damage to our client's car. The defendant driver was insured by Farmers Insurance, which initially responded to our client's notice of claim by stating, "Based on our investigation and our review of the responding officer's body camera footage it does not appear there was any mechanism for injury to your client resulting from this collision. Since our investigation suggests the low-velocity impact would not cause the injuries claimed, we contest them on our insured's behalf and deny liability for bodily injury alleged from this accident." Previously, our client had been in two other motor vehicle collisions with a history of neck and back injuries and treatment. In this collision, she also suffered neck and back injuries. She required a low back fusion surgery (specifically, L5-S1 right transforaminal lumbar interbody fusion). We persuaded Farmers Insurance to pay its insured's policy limits of $250,000, despite Farmers' initial denial of any and all liability.

Total Settlement: $250,000

A dangerous dog attacked a 9-year old boy as he played with friends at the neighborhood park in Sammamish. The child was bitten on his upper left arm causing deep, tearing wounds. Despite initially accepting fault for the dog bite, the dog owners hired an attorney to challenge King County Animal Control's dangerous dog declaration and to defend the personal injury claims of the boy. Our investigation revealed that at the request of King County Animal Control and the dog owners' attorney, the dog underwent a behavioral assessment that determined the dog should not be unattended with visitors in its home, people in the community, and especially children.

At mediation, the case settled for the dog owners' State Farm homeowners insurance policy limits plus a significant personal cash contribution.

Total Settlement: $226,000, including cash contribution from dog owners
